  • Abstract
    In this note we propose a strategy for the synthesis of dynamic regulators for uncertain systems. The controller might be calculated so that some performance requirements (pole placement) are satisfied in any, fixed, point of the uncertain domain. Once the (quadratic) controller is calculated, its robustness is evaluated by means of a simple linear programming approach
